The funeral of inspirational Tetbury dad Fran Eddolls took place this morning.

Fran was diagnosed with an incurable brain tumour in April and passed away on Monday, July 13.

Hundreds of people lined the streets to pay tribute to the hugely popular father-of-two, whose story has touched not just his family and friends, but the entire Tetbury community and beyond.

Fran was a hugely popular member of the community and was an avid sportsman. Although often seen on his bike, he also competed for local football clubs Tetbury Town and Avonvale United over a number of seasons.

Over the years Fran raised thousands of pounds for various charities through cycling challenges, and the community united to support him in his time of need by donating to help his family.

Friends and relatives raised almost £16,000 in just a matter of days following Fran’s diagnosis by taking part in Le Tour De Fran, with the money going to Fran, his wife Carina and their children Holly, aged four, and two-year-old Archie, so they could make the most of the time they had left as a family.
